Olusegun Obasanjo Slammed National Assembly , Says It Is Swathing Degeneracy

Former President Chief Olusegun Obasanjo

One time Military President and the first democratically elected President of the Federal Republic of Nigeria, Chief Olusegun Obasanjo'  has blasted the National Assembly on its sleazy attitudes  towards the discharge of assigned duties to the Nigerian citizenry.

The former President in his address at the public exhibition of  “The Story Of My Two Worlds; Challenges, Experiences And Achievements”  which is a book written by Justice Akanbi, who is the pioneer chairman of the Independent Corrupt Practices and Related Offences Commission [ICPC], bemoaned that it's very unfortunate that NASS has swathed degeneracy through its impervious budget, and this has marred its sovereignty towards scrutinizing the executive.


He reproached the President Goodluck Jonathan-led executive of carrying out direct remunerations to the NASS to cloak its atrocities.

He said it's very disheartening that depravity has eaten deep into every segment of Nigeria's state life.

In his exact words "“Apart from shrouding the remunerations of the National Assembly in opaqueness and without transparency, they indulge in extorting money from departments, contractors and ministries in two ways", the ex President said.
